About A. Han
A. Han is a scholar working on Aging, Radiation, Radiology, Nuclear Medicine and Imaging, Dermatology and Immunology, having authored 39 papers that have together received 780 indexed citations. Recurring topics across this work include Radiation Therapy and Dosimetry (10 papers), Effects of Radiation Exposure (9 papers), bioluminescence and chemiluminescence research (8 papers), Reproductive System and Pregnancy (8 papers), Reproductive Biology and Fertility (7 papers), Extracellular vesicles in disease (5 papers), Advanced Radiotherapy Techniques (5 papers) and Radiation Effects and Dosimetry (4 papers). The work is most often cited by research in Radiation (123 citations), Radiology, Nuclear Medicine and Imaging (310 citations), Cancer Research (175 citations), Pulmonary and Respiratory Medicine (334 citations) and Dermatology (72 citations). A. Han has collaborated with scholars based in United States, South Korea and Saudi Arabia. Frequent co-authors include M. M. Elkind, C.K. Hill, Robert L. Wells, Franco M. Buonaguro, Fumio Suzuki, George R. Lankas, Hiroshi Utsumi, B.A. Carnes, Jennifer G. Peak and Meyrick J. Peak. Their work appears in journals such as Radiation Research, Theriogenology, Photochemistry and Photobiology, Reproductive Toxicology and Molecular & Cellular Proteomics.
